CIS-1,2-BIS(PHENYLSULFONYL)ETHYLENE, an organic compound with the chemical formula C14H12O4S2, is known for its role as a reagent in organic synthesis, especially in the formation of carbon-carbon bonds. It is recognized for its function as a cross-linking agent for polymers, contributing to the production of materials such as plastics and adhesives. CIS-1,2-BIS(PHENYLSULFONYL)ETHYLENE has also garnered interest for its potential applications in pharmaceuticals and agrochemicals. Despite its relative stability and non-reactivity under normal conditions, it is advised to handle CIS-1,2-BIS(PHENYLSULFONYL)ETHYLENE with care and follow proper safety protocols.

963-15-5 Usage

Uses

Used in Organic Synthesis:
CIS-1,2-BIS(PHENYLSULFONYL)ETHYLENE is used as a reagent for the formation of carbon-carbon bonds, which is crucial in the synthesis of various organic compounds.
Used in Polymer Production:
In the polymer industry, CIS-1,2-BIS(PHENYLSULFONYL)ETHYLENE is used as a cross-linking agent, enhancing the properties of materials such as plastics and adhesives by improving their structural integrity and durability.
Used in Pharmaceutical Development:
CIS-1,2-BIS(PHENYLSULFONYL)ETHYLENE has been studied for its potential applications in pharmaceuticals, indicating its possible use as a precursor or component in the development of new drugs.
Used in Agrochemical Formulation:
CIS-1,2-BIS(PHENYLSULFONYL)ETHYLENE is also being explored for its potential use in agrochemicals, suggesting that it could be utilized in the development of pesticides or other agricultural chemicals to improve crop protection and yield.

Check Digit Verification of cas no

The CAS Registry Mumber 963-15-5 includes 6 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 3 digits, 9,6 and 3 respectively; the second part has 2 digits, 1 and 5 respectively.
Calculate Digit Verification of CAS Registry Number 963-15:
(5*9)+(4*6)+(3*3)+(2*1)+(1*5)=85
85 % 10 = 5
So 963-15-5 is a valid CAS Registry Number.

An alternative, inexpensive preparation of phenylsulfonylethylene

Cossu, Sergio,De Lucchi, Ottorino,Durr, Richard,Fabris, Fabrizio

, p. 211 - 216 (2007/10/03)

The reaction of (Z)-1,2-bis(phenylsulfonyl)ethylene with tributyltin hydride gives quantitatively phenylsulfonylethylene and constitutes an alternative and inexpensive preparation of this widely used reagent. The reaction also occurs with silicon hydrides (Pd catalyst) and sodium borohydride but the former reaction is not as clean as with tin hydridese while the latter gives the over reduced product phenylsulfonylethane.
